Conception and birth of a child is a complex and perfect mechanism consisting of many regulatory links. One of them is the corpus luteum of the ovary. This is a small endocrine gland that produces the pregnancy hormone progesterone. Ovulation is the process of the release of an egg from an ovarian follicle, after which it begins its movement through the fallopian tubes to the uterus. In place of the burst follicle, an endocrine organ is formed - the corpus luteum. This is a temporary gland that produces several hormones: progesterone, a small amount of estrogens, androgens, inhibins, relaxin, oxytocin. All of them, and above all progesterone, are necessary for the normal course of pregnancy.

Scheme of egg maturation, ovulation and formation of the corpus luteum

When an egg meets a sperm, conception occurs. The embryo begins its long “life” cycle. This process is regulated in the first trimester of pregnancy by the hormones of the corpus luteum. Its existence becomes “unnecessary” only after the placenta is fully formed. After 12-16 weeks of pregnancy it involutions.

If conception does not occur in this cycle, the gland also disappears. The inner layer of the uterus is shed, which is the beginning of menstrual bleeding.

Stages of organ formation:

  • Proliferation is the initial stage. After ovulation, under the influence of luteinizing hormone of the pituitary gland (LH), active division of ovarian cells occurs, which fill the cavity of the burst follicle.
  • Vascularization. The development of capillaries and small blood vessels, without which the long-term existence of the organ is impossible.
  • Bloom. The organ actively produces progesterone. It reaches its maximum size, which makes it possible to diagnose the corpus luteum on ultrasound.
  • Fading. The gland ceases to exist and turns into a scar, which then completely resolves. Menstruation begins.

Each stage of development has its own “picture” during ultrasound examination, which makes it possible to diagnose various stages of the ovulatory cycle and suspect ovarian pathology or disorders leading to infertility.

Functions of the organ

What role does the corpus luteum play in the ovary for the normal course of pregnancy? Let's take a closer look at this process.

After ovulation, the body has approximately two weeks to prepare for the embryo to implant into the wall of the uterus. The leading role in this process is played by the corpus luteum, which is formed from steroidogenic ovarian tissue under the influence of luteinizing hormone of the pituitary gland. Progesterone (steroid hormone of the corpus luteum) performs the following functions:

  • stimulates thickening and “loosening” of the inner layer in the uterus, which facilitates implantation of the embryo (attaching it to the wall of the uterus);
  • reduces contractile function of the uterus; regulates the increase in the size of the uterus; affects the glandular tissue of the mammary glands (preparation for lactation);
  • inhibits the maturation of new follicles;
  • strengthens the muscle ring of the cervix, which prevents premature birth.

If for some reason the corpus luteum does not develop or stops developing prematurely (before 8-9 weeks of pregnancy), the conditions for normal development of the embryo disappear and a miscarriage occurs.

Ultrasound diagnostics

The main instrumental method for studying processes occurring during pregnancy is sonography. It combines sufficient information content and safety for the fetus. But often the description of ultrasound results raises questions among pregnant women. What does the corpus luteum look like on an ultrasound?

Indications for ultrasound examination of the ovaries are:

  • Pregnancy planning. Detection of the corpus luteum on an ultrasound means that ovulation has occurred and conception can be planned.
  • Diagnosis of multiple pregnancy. The number of corpora lutea coincides with the number of follicles and accordingly shows how many fetuses there will be if fertilization is successful.
  • Monitoring the effectiveness of infertility therapy (caused by hormonal disorders).
  • Diagnosis of the cystic process in the ovaries. Often cysts form precisely at the site of the corpus luteum.

If these indications exist, they are not limited to a single ultrasound examination. During one cycle, sonography is performed 3-4 times. The most optimal timing is as follows: immediately after the end of menstruation, after expected ovulation (approximately on the 15-16th day of the cycle) and on the 22-23rd day of the menstrual cycle.

Research methodology

Ultrasound diagnostics of the corpus luteum is carried out in fundamentally different ways. Preparation for the procedure also depends on this.

  1. Traditional transabdominal (through the anterior abdominal wall). In this case, the bladder should be as full as possible, which will improve the conductivity of ultrasonic waves. To do this, immediately before the study you need to drink at least 0.5 liters of liquid.
  2. Transvaginal (through the vagina using a special ultrasound sensor). This method is more informative, since the corpus luteum is too small. The bladder, on the contrary, must be emptied.

It is important that the intestinal loops, swollen due to gas formation, do not block the passage of ultrasonic waves. Therefore, a day before the procedure, you must exclude all dairy products, baked goods, vegetables, and fruits.

Menstrual cycles occur regularly throughout several decades of a woman's fertile life. Each time the female body prepares for conception and, if the fusion of germ cells does not occur, it begins the process all over again. One of the most important structures, which is necessary not only for the fusion of gametes to take place, but also for the successful course of pregnancy, is the corpus luteum of the ovary.

The concept of the corpus luteum: what does it look like and what is it?

The corpus luteum (CL) is a temporary endocrine gland that is formed from an ovarian follicle after a certain period of time. During the menstrual cycle it is 2 weeks, and during the gestation period it is 10–12 weeks. Afterwards it degenerates into scar tissue. This area is called the white body, and over time it also disappears.

Why is VT called yellow? It got its name due to its appearance. This is a round formation of yellow ovarian follicle granulosa cells. In the left ovary it is smaller than in the right.

You can only find out that a corpus luteum has formed in the body with the help of special studies:

  • Blood test for progesterone. The gland produces progesterone, its production decreases as the corpus luteum degenerates. Laboratory analysis allows you to determine the amount of the hormone in the body.
  • Ultrasound of the ovary. The monitor will show a small heterogeneous formation on the ovary. It depends on where exactly the gland is located whether it will be visible or not.
  • Folliculometry. The most accurate way to monitor the size of the corpus luteum after ovulation. Monitoring begins on the first day of the cycle and ultrasound is done every 1–2 days until the gland becomes visible.

Functions and types

There are two types of corpus luteum: sexual cycle VT and gravidar VT. Why is VT needed? The main task of the corpus luteum is the production of the hormone progesterone. If pregnancy does not occur, the need for progesterone and, as a result, the gland itself disappears. During gestation, education is necessary until the placenta can produce the hormone on its own.

Progesterone performs a number of functions:

  • prepares the endometrium of the uterus for implantation;
  • thickens cervical mucus;
  • reduces immunity during pregnancy;
  • reduces the tone of the uterus.

How long does it function?

How long does a VT live? The corpus luteum has a limited lifespan, but it is formed every month during the menstrual cycle. The functioning of the formation depends on whether the fusion of gametes has occurred or ovulation has been wasted and menstruation should begin.


If the fusion of gametes does not occur, the function of the corpus luteum gland begins to fade from the 12th day after ovulation. In a 28-day cycle, this is day 26. It dries out, gradually degenerating into scar tissue, producing less and less progesterone, which is why the endometrium of the uterus begins to shed. Menstruation, as a result of endometrial rejection, accompanied by bleeding, is a consequence of the extinction of VT function.

What happens to the corpus luteum during ovulation and pregnancy?

If fertilization occurs during ovulation, the corpus luteum retains its size and continues to produce progesterone. The hormone is needed so that the embryo is implanted into the loosened endometrium and is not rejected by the mother’s immune system, and then it reduces the tone of the uterus and prevents miscarriage.

During pregnancy, the corpus luteum is necessary only in the early stages. When the placenta takes over its functions, it begins to regress, as before menstruation in the menstrual cycle.

Corpus luteum cyst

Normally, in the absence of gestation, on the 13th day after ovulation, the corpus luteum should enter a regression phase. However, this does not always happen, and the gland tissue continues to grow and hypertrophy. This is how a corpus luteum cyst appears, in which intracellular fluid accumulates.

Cyst symptoms:

  • absence or delay of menstruation;
  • weak aching pain in the lower abdomen;
  • unpleasant, painful sensations during sexual intercourse.

As a rule, such cysts do not grow larger than 8 cm and do not require treatment. They resolve on their own after 2–3 months. Depending on the size of the tumor, the doctor selects therapy. If the tumor does not resolve, drug treatment or even surgical removal is required.

Place of origin

A doctor performing an ultrasound can diagnose the presence of a corpus luteum on both the right and left ovaries - it all depends on the female body. The formation of the gland usually occurs sequentially, now on one, then on the other. There is no fundamental difference for pregnancy - in both cases this only means the readiness of the egg to meet the sperm, which will lead to conception.

There is an opinion that the sex of the child depends on the place of formation of the corpus luteum - if it is on the right ovary, then there will be a girl, and on the left it will be a boy. There is no scientific basis for this method of determining the sex of the fetus, and any case confirming it is a coincidence.
